If a triangle has sides of 8,11, and 13. Is it a right triangle?

If a² + b² = c², then the triangle is right.

So we have (8)² + (11)²  ?  (13)²

(8)² is 64, (11)² is 121, and (13)² is 169.

So we have 64 + 121 ? 169

64 + 121 is 185 and we can see that 185 > 169.

This triangle would not be a right triangle.

In fact, it would be an acute triangle.

So no, it's not a right triangle.
